Aside from having a brand new stadium for the sole use of ourselves, there are three possible and less palatable alternatives:
1. staying at Belle Vue
2. Merger
3. Groundshare with Cas

Only the last one will guarantee top flight rugby league for Wakefield Trinity for the long term. The ground is in Wakefield, and was announced as a new ground for Wakefield. If Cas want to borrow someone else's ground every other Sunday, that is up to them, but for me, a ground in Wakefield will always be the Wakefield ground. Make sure the seats are red and blue and it's job done.

: Mon Apr 20, 2009 5:05 pm  
Nothing is decided - yet.

My take on this would be that whilst a gorundshare seems to make much sense from a cost saving point of view, at the end of the day, there will only be one set of corporate facilities / one set of dining facilities and one set of education facilities etc.... As such, you can only charge them out once.

So, let's look at the current jargon from the RFL - they want viable businesses who can generate £4m turnover - and whilst not being impossible by sharing facilities, it will certainly add to the issues. This in turn could be the reasoning behind a future merger, especially if both clubs have sold their grounds!

This would be my one and only fear - albeit a large one - but the one mitigating factor is that, if this did happen, the ground is in Wakey - that in itself is possibly the fear that will haunt the Cas' contingent - it certainly would me if we were talking about Glasshoughton as a shared home.

Genuinely uncertain of whether the Cas' board could sell this to their fans - regardless of who is asking them to do so. :?

I agree. It would be Gateshead and Sheffield all over again, as it would become a Wakefield club. I disagree with the view expressed before that the area couldn't support 2 stadia. It has done for many decades, and any new stadia would have different catchments for the corporate stuff. Cas would cast their net York and Selby way, and we would look to Wakefield. If corporate attractability becomes the criteria, then maybe the game really would have lost its soul.
